Texas Solar Incentives: Local and Utility Rebates
There are no direct Texas solar incentives, but many municipalities and local utilities offer incentives to help homeowners and businesses. These incentives are provided in order to encourage them to adopt renewable energy. You can check the list of local rebates across Texas here.
Utility Company Incentives:
Oncor Electric Delivery: Oncor Electric Delivery offers many financial incentives to the solar contractors which they can pass on to the customers who purchase the qualifying solar power systems.
AEP Texas: AEP Texas a solar PV incentive program. This program offers financial incentives to help reduce the initial cost of installing a solar power system.
Garland Power & Light (GP&L): GP&L offers bill credits for solar panel installation. The solar rebate of $0.75 per watt, up to $5,000 per system, is renewed every October and is available until funds are exhausted.
Tumblr media
Local Government Incentives:
SMTX Utilities (San Marcos): SMTX Utilities also has a rebate program offering a $2,500 rebate program for homeowners who install solar photovoltaic (PV) systems. It aims to promote solar power systems in Texas. For more details, you can visit the official SMTC Utilities website.
City of Sunset Valley: Residents of Sunset Valley who qualify for the Austin Energy solar rebate can receive extra Texas solar incentives from the city. The city offers an additional $1 per watt rebate of a maximum of $3,000 (if the solar power system cost doesn’t exceed $6,000). For more details on how specific eligibility criteria you can visit the official website of Sunset Valley.
NOTE: Texas solar incentives can reduce the upfront costs of solar power installations. However, the availability of these programs may vary based on your location and utility provider. For updated information, you can consult your local utility company or State Incentives for Renewables & Efficiency (DSIRE).

Solar Buyback Programs
Solar buyback programs allow homeowners to sell excess electricity generated by solar panels back to the grid. In return, they can receive credits on their electricity bill. It helps to reduce the electricity bills.
TXU Energy: TXU Energy offers solar buyback plans allowing Texas homeowners to earn credits for the extra solar energy generated. These credits can offset up to 100% of your monthly energy charges.
Octopus Energy: Similarly, Octopus Energy provides a solar buyback program with unlimited credits that roll over without expiration. It allows you to take maximum benefits of the solar energy production.
Gexa Energy: Gexa Energy offers plans that let you sell back your unused solar energy and reduce electricity costs.

Federal Solar Investment Tax Credit (ITC)
The Federal Solar Investment Tax Credit (ITC) deducts a certain percentage of your solar panel installation costs from your federal taxes. For systems installed between 2022 and 2032, you can claim 30% of the cost of installing solar panels. It includes both equipment and labor costs.
Tumblr media
You Own the New Solar Panel System: If you have fully installed a new solar panel system outright or through financing, you are eligible for it. Leasing or signing a power purchase agreement (PPA) does not qualify for the same. It doesn’t apply to refurbished ones.
The Panels are Installed at a Qualifying Property: The solar panels must be installed at your home which includes: primary/secondary residence or rental properties that allow installation in the United States. Leased properties don’t qualify for it.
You Must Owe Federal Taxes: As ITC is a tax credit you must ower federal taxes to take advantage of it. In case your credit exceeds what you owe, you can roll the remainder next year.
Battery Storage May Count: As of the new updates in 2023, you can also be eligible for credit if your solar panel system includes a battery with a storage capacity of 3 kilowatt-hours or more.
NOTE: It’s important to note that this tax credit is non-refundable, meaning it can reduce your tax liability to zero, but you won’t receive a refund for any remaining credit. However, any unused credit can be carried forward to the next tax year.
How to Claim Texas Solar Incentives
Install Your Solar Energy System: Choose a solar provider and install your solar power systems. The installation must be completed during the tax year for which you’re claiming the credit. If it is not done, you can claim it in the next year.
Gather Necessary Documentation: Keep a proper record of all the expenses related to the installation in the form of invoices or receipts. It will support your claim for the federal tax credit.
Complete IRS Form 5695 and Submit: When filing your federal income tax return, fill out Form 5695, titled “Residential Energy Credits.” This form helps you calculate the credit amount based on your solar installation costs. Include the completed Form 5695 with your annual tax return to claim the credit.

Does Texas offer incentives for solar panels? Yes, Texas offers several incentives for solar panel installation, including federal tax credits, property tax exemptions, and utility or local rebates. However, there is no statewide net metering policy.
How much is the solar tax exemption in Texas? In Texas, the property tax exemption eliminates any increase in property taxes due to the added value of a solar energy system. This means you won’t pay extra property taxes even if your home’s value rises because of the solar installation.
Is Texas a good state for solar? Absolutely. With abundant sunshine, falling solar installation costs, and various incentives, Texas is one of the best states for solar energy adoption.
Is Texas more solar than California? Yes, Texas has surpassed California in utility-scale solar capacity, making it a leader in solar energy growth.
Do homes in Texas sell faster with solar? Homes with solar panels often sell faster and at a higher price in Texas because buyers value the long-term energy savings and environmental benefits.

Numbers that shine: Exploring the Financial Dynamics of Solar Energy:
Affordable Entry Point: As of 2023, a typical 6.6kW system in Sydney costs between $6,500 and $9,500. As an initial investment, it quickly pays for itself.
Powerhouse Potential: Imagine a 5kW system generating 20kWh of electricity per day, which could save you up to $50,000 over its lifetime! That has a significant impact on your energy costs.
Annual Savings, Year-Round Joy: With a 6.6kW system, you can expect to save $1,000-$2,000 per year, or more than $3,000 with an 8kW system. Enjoy the financial freedom and peace of mind that come with lower energy bills.
Unlocking Savings: How Does Solar Provide Financial Benefits?
Self-Consumption is Key: Directly utilise the electricity your panels generate to power your home, reducing reliance on the grid and the need for purchased electricity. The more you consume for yourself, the faster you'll see a return on investment.
Feed-In Tariff Bonus: Sell any excess energy you generate back to the grid and earn a feed-in tariff of approximately 10 cents per kWh (rates vary by state and retailer). While maximising self-consumption remains the most beneficial strategy, this provides an additional incentive.
Battery Power: The Future is Bright (and stored):  Excess solar energy can be stored and used whenever needed, including at night and during power outages. While battery prices are falling, current estimates indicate that they may not reach payback as quickly as panels. Many homeowners prioritise solar panels installation first to achieve immediate savings and environmental benefits, and then consider battery storage afterwards.
Government Green Light: Going solar becomes even more appealing with government rebates available for CEC-approved installations. In Australia, you could save up to $1,800 a year on a 6.6kW system. These rebates incentivise the switch to solar, making it a more appealing option.

Looks like the source article included a "million" after the 1.6 that OP forgot to include, so it's actually 1.6 gigawatts, which makes a little more sense. Though...
The audit also revealed that the school district could save at least $2.4 million over 20 years if it outfitted Batesville High School with more than 1,400 solar panels and updated all of the district’s facilities with new lights, heating and cooling systems
So per year, that's supposed to be $240,000, which is notably less than their $250,000 budget deficit, and considerably less than the $1.8 million surplus they're claiming. Is that just the audit's lower-end estimate underestimating the energy savings by an order of magnitude?
That's especially weird, since... apparently, if I'm reading this right, they avoid installation costs by having the developer cover the cost of installation, and then pay the developer like a utility (at, ostensibly, a reduced rate) in perpetuity. They don't actually own the panels, and don't get a cut of whatever excess power the developer is selling to the grid.
Their total annual utility bill is $600k, so even if the developer is giving away the energy for free, the biggest annual surplus they can get from just installing solar this way is $350k. (or -$10k, if the audit's estimate was correct.) Where's that $1.8 million coming from? How many teachers do they have to pay? Did they just install the panels and then just unrelatedly raise teacher salaries using some other part of the budget because that's a good PR move, and then claim the money came from the solar panels they don't own? Is the developer kicking back profits from the excess they sell to the grid? Or are some of these numbers not accurate?

Federal Solar Incentives
Before diving into Virginia’s state-specific incentives, it's important to note the federal solar incentives that apply across the United States, including Virginia. The Investment Tax Credit (ITC) is the most significant federal solar incentive.
Investment Tax Credit (ITC)
The ITC allows homeowners and businesses to claim a tax credit equal to a percentage of the cost of installing solar panels. As of 2024, the ITC offers a 30% tax credit for solar panel systems. This means that if you install a solar system for $20,000, you can claim a tax credit of $6,000, significantly reducing the upfront cost. The ITC is a valuable incentive that has helped many Virginians make the transition to solar.

Virginia Solar Renewable Energy Certificates (SRECs)
One of the primary incentives in Virginia is the Solar Renewable Energy Certificate (SREC) program. SRECs are certificates earned for every 1,000 kWh (kilowatt-hours) of electricity produced by a solar panel system. When you install solar panels, you can earn SRECs for the energy your system generates. These certificates can then be sold to utility companies that are required to meet renewable energy goals set by the state. The price of SRECs fluctuates, but it can provide a valuable revenue stream for homeowners and businesses with solar systems.
By participating in the SREC market, you can recoup some of the costs of installing your solar panels, which can make the transition to solar more affordable. Keep in mind that SREC prices can vary, so it’s important to monitor the market to maximize your earnings.
Net Metering in Virginia
Net metering is another significant solar incentive in Virginia. Net metering allows homeowners with solar panel systems to receive credits for excess electricity that is fed back into the grid. If your solar system generates more electricity than you need, the excess power is sent to the utility grid, and you receive credits on your electricity bill.
These credits can be used to offset future electricity consumption. For example, if your solar panels generate more electricity in the summer months than you use, you can carry over those credits to the winter months when your system might not be generating as much energy. Net metering helps homeowners save money on their electricity bills by ensuring that no energy goes to waste.
Virginia’s Solar Equipment Sales Tax Exemption
Virginia offers a sales tax exemption for solar equipment, making it more affordable to install solar systems. When you purchase solar panels and related equipment (such as inverters, batteries, and mounting hardware), you won’t have to pay the state’s 5.3% sales tax. This exemption can save you hundreds or even thousands of dollars, depending on the size and scope of your solar installation.
The sales tax exemption is available for both residential and commercial solar installations, making it a valuable incentive for Virginians looking to invest in clean energy.
Property Tax Exemption for Solar Installations
In Virginia, the installation of solar panels is exempt from property taxes. This means that if you add solar panels to your home, the value of the system will not increase your property taxes. This exemption can be a significant advantage, as it ensures that you will not face higher tax bills after your solar system is installed.
Many homeowners worry that the increased value of their home from solar panels will lead to higher property taxes, but in Virginia, this is not the case. This tax exemption is designed to incentivize homeowners to invest in renewable energy without the fear of additional tax burdens.
Virginia Clean Energy Financing Programs
To make solar panel installations more accessible, Virginia offers financing programs designed to help homeowners pay for their solar systems. These programs allow homeowners to finance the cost of their solar systems over a longer period, often with lower interest rates. Some of these programs include Property Assessed Clean Energy (PACE) financing, which enables homeowners to repay the cost of their solar installation through property taxes.
These financing options can make the upfront cost of installing solar panels much more manageable, especially for those who may not have the cash available for a full installation upfront.

Federal Investment Tax Credit (ITC)
The ITC allows you to deduct 30% of the cost of installing a solar energy system from your federal taxes. This includes expenses for equipment, labor, and permitting. For example, if your solar system costs $10,000, you could receive a $3,000 tax credit.
To qualify, you must own the system (purchased outright or financed) and have sufficient tax liability to benefit from the credit. The ITC is set to decrease to 26% in 2033 and 22% in 2034, expiring in 2035.
Net Metering and Buyback Programs
Some Texas utilities offer net metering or buyback programs, allowing you to receive credits for excess electricity your solar system generates and sends back to the grid. These credits can offset your electricity costs, potentially leading to lower utility bills. Availability and terms vary by utility company.
State Property Tax Exemption
In Texas, installing solar panels can increase your property’s value. However, the state offers a property tax exemption, meaning the added value from your solar system won’t be taxed. This helps you keep your property taxes stable even after installing solar panels.

FAQs: Are Solar Panels Worth it in Texas
Is Texas paying people to go solar? While Texas doesn’t have a statewide program that directly pays individuals to install solar panels, many local utilities and municipalities offer rebates and incentives. For example, Austin Energy provides a $2,500 rebate for residential solar installations.
Is Texas a solar-friendly state? Yes, Texas is considered a solar-friendly state. The Texas Property Code Section 202.010 ensures that homeowners associations cannot outright prohibit the installation of solar energy devices, making it easier for residents to adopt solar energy.
Can a city in Texas not let you go solar? Generally, cities in Texas cannot outright prohibit solar installations due to state laws protecting homeowners’ rights to install solar energy devices. However, they may have specific regulations regarding the placement and appearance of solar panels.
